The ITIL® Operational Support and Analysis (OSA) Certificate is one of the ITIL Intermediate Capability modules you can opt for to delve deeper into certain processes in the Service Lifecycle. These processes include Event Management, Incident Management, Problem Management, Access Management, and Request Fulfilment. By choosing the ITIL OSA Certificate, you will:
- Understand the Operational Support and Analysis processes in your company and how you can enhance these processes to improve your organization’s services and service delivery
- Discover the latest methods to provide support to your customers
- Learn new ways to organize process activities to meet your company’s goals

In an ITIL V3 Operational Support and Analysis course, students will learn how to plan, implement, and optimize OSA processes. Practical guidance, based upon tested industry methods, is provided. Students will learn how to design and implement integrated end-to-end OSA processes, including Incident Management, Problem Management, Event Management, Request Fulfillment, Access Management, and the Service Desk. The roles, methods, functions, and activities in Operational Support and Analysis are also discussed to ensure a candidate comprehends how critical OSA is to the Service Lifecycle. In addition, students will further their understanding of the Service Lifecycle phases and how to implement them in a real-world business setting. At the end of the training course, students will be fully prepared to take and pass the ITIL OSA Certification exam.
Those interested in this course must already possess an ITIL Foundation Certificate. It is recommended that candidates also have at least two years of experience in IT Service Management. Students who pass the ITIL OSA course will be awarded 4 credits towards the ITIL Expert qualification.
